Output d81d5963369687806791d64e3cf31ee5cac8755dc8bedb51ec3027b287de209d:0

value
51826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8551e09822624d53d35e3e8b11c811695f9ed1f0 OP_EQUAL
address
3DqwszZTRkVhq9fPtZX3kFVrBzy5XjAQmm
transaction
d81d5963369687806791d64e3cf31ee5cac8755dc8bedb51ec3027b287de209d
spent
true